Transaction 503fc4a32f29cf9352cf7842ac10028be62654c8d9e99f06b80f62e273217dcc

12 Input
2 Outputs
  • 503fc4a32f29cf9352cf7842ac10028be62654c8d9e99f06b80f62e273217dcc:0
  • value  199672905
    address  35yTToQ6QW2RVbDkSWFj6yM4F7RxEB1vMH
  • 503fc4a32f29cf9352cf7842ac10028be62654c8d9e99f06b80f62e273217dcc:1
  • value  105158151
    address  3LyzYcB54pm9EAMmzXpFfb1kzEDAFvqBgT